發布時間: 2017-07-28 09:35:20
騰科小編今天給大家推薦的內容是Python已在開發者群體中人氣登頂、三款最佳開源報告工具深度剖析、IT外包形勢展望和21項定則成就更快SQL查詢速度等。
一、Python已在開發者群體中人氣登頂
已經在開發者群體當中擁有良好支持度的Python語言近期再登新高峰,根據權威機構調查報告顯示,它已然成為開發人員最喜愛的語言選項。下面,我們將一同了解前十大開發工具完整排名。
1. Pyton
2. Git
3. Visual Studio IDE
4. Eclipse IDE
5. Java
6. Notepad++
7. Linux
8. R
9. Docker
10. 微軟Excel
二、三款最佳開源報告工具深度剖析
為后端數據庫,特別是接入Web應用程序的后端數據庫生成專業且同需求相匹配的報告一直是Web開發領域的一大難題。此類商用產品不僅數量稀少,且價格也令個人與中小型企業很難承受。面對這樣的現實挑戰,我們只能將目光投向開源領域,而這正是我們今天的議題,評測三款最佳開源報告工具。
1. JasperReports
2. Pentaho
3. BIRT(商務智能與報告工具)項目
三、IT外包形勢展望,七項因素趨熱,七項因素趨冷
隨著IT組織在戰略性層面的不斷提升,其同IT外包供應商間的合作也在持續升溫。數字化轉型、自動化乃至數據革命的到來不僅重塑著IT事務的面貌,同時也給IT外包服務的類型與數量帶來深遠影響。因此,如果你正在關注IT外包業務的具體技術、戰略以及客戶需求轉變,那么,以下來提到的十四項重要趨勢顯得不容錯過。
趨熱:
1. 快速軟件開發
2. 云整合
3. 人才戰爭
4. 自動化成果
5. 離岸人工技術交付中心
6. 民粹主義與保護主義
7. 商務指標
趨冷:
1. IT服務孤島
2. 傳統遠程基礎設施管理
3. 人口紅利
4. 自動化炒作
5. 低成本服務臺與服務中心
6. H-1B恐慌
7. IT服務業增長
四、21項定則成就更快SQL查詢速度
相信每位朋友都希望擁有更快的數據庫查詢速度,而SQL開發者與DBA們也一直在利用各種最佳實踐方法達成這項目標。盡管不存在那種百試百靈的性能提升途徑,但從廣義層面來看,查詢性能的調優工作確實存在一定規律。下面,我們將立足21項定則,聊聊如何有效改善SQL查詢表現。
1. 盡量避免使用指針
2. 必須使用指針時,使用臨時表
3. 使用臨時表時,請認真考量
4. 對數據進行預備
5. 盡可能減少嵌套查看
6. 使用CASE代替UPDATE
7. 使用表-值代替標量
8. 在SQL Server中使用分區
9. 批量刪除與更新
10. 不要盲目求快
11. 回避ORM
12. 盡可能使用已保存規程
13. 避免雙重查詢
14. 將大型事務拆分為小型事務
15. 不要拉取觸發器
16. 避免對GUID進行聚類
17. 不要在表內進行全部計數
18. 使用系統表進行行數統計
19. 僅拉取您需要的列數量
20. 重寫查詢以避免無結果
21. 不要盲目復用代碼